Watch Satellite TV On Your PC

Did you know the latest buzz in the satellite television industry is that you can now watch satellite tv on your pc for free? Besides being able to watch free satellite tv channels, you can also record the tv shows as well as connect it to your television or plasma tv if you prefer to watch satellite tv on your TV.

To watch satellite tv on your pc, you will need either a satellite tv software or a PCTV card installed on your computer. The PCTV card nowadays comes in both external and internal. The external version can be plugged into any USB port and is suitable for laptop users. The internal version slots into the PCI slot on your desktop computer. You may need some help if you are not familiar with installing cards on your desktop computer.

The PCTV card contains a processor that enables it to decode satellite signals and transform it into digital signals that can be output on your computer monitor. Since it performs the decoding on the PCTV card, it is less processor intensive than a purely software satellite tv software. This allows a smoother and higher quality satellite tv playback on your PC.

To watch satellite tv on your pc, the minimum specification for your computer would be stated on the PCTV card or the satellite tv software. Usually, you need at least a Pentium III 500 Mhz processor with at least 256 MB RAM. Your operating system should be at least windows 2000/XP as well. A sound card is also needed and if you are using the external PCTV version, a USB port needs to be available as well.

You can connect your internet cable directly to the PCTV card or use a third party product such as Hauppauge 3000. For some satellite tv software, it is even simpler. All you need is to make sure your computer is connected to the internet.

I do recommend you have at least a broadband speed of 512kbps and above in order for smoother satellite tv playback.

Besides watching satellite tv on your PC, you can also record the channels if you wish to. I would advise getting a larger capacity hard drive as it can take up a lot of space when you record satellite tv channels.
